What are collective nouns used for adult cats?

Collective nouns used for adult cats include clowder, clutter, pounce, and destruction.

A clowder is a group of cats, while a clutter is a group of kittens. A pounce is a group of cats that are stalking or hunting prey, while a destruction is a group of cats that are causing chaos or destruction.

Clowder Etymology: Why Is a Group of Cats Called a Clowder? According to Teresa Keiger, self-proclaimed word nerd and creative director of the Cat Fanciers' Association, the word clowder is English. Its origins trace back to the word "clotern," like other well-known words such as "clot," "clutter" and "cluster."
